When Your Cloud Goes Virtual: Mastering Virtualization Security in Cloud Computing

Picture this: you’ve just migrated your entire digital empire to the cloud. Servers hum (virtually, of course), data flows like a digital river, and you’re ready to conquer the business world. Then, a tiny glitch appears – a digital gremlin has decided to play hide-and-seek within your virtual machines. Suddenly, “cloud computing” feels a lot less like a fluffy white dream and more like a slightly damp, anxious nightmare. This, my friends, is where the often-underestimated, yet critically important, realm of virtualization security in cloud computing steps onto the stage, armed with firewalls and a healthy dose of paranoia.

For many organizations, virtualization is the magic wand that unlocked the cloud’s potential. It allows us to slice and dice physical hardware into countless isolated environments, each acting as its own mini-computer. This agility is fantastic, but it also introduces a whole new layer of complexity when it comes to keeping things secure. We’re not just protecting one big server anymore; we’re safeguarding a bustling metropolis of virtual tenants, each with its own needs and, potentially, its own vulnerabilities.

The “Oops, I Didn’t See That” Vulnerabilities

It’s easy to get caught up in the glamour of cloud migration and forget that virtualization itself has its own unique attack vectors. Think of it like building a magnificent skyscraper. You’ve got robust foundations (the physical hardware) and beautiful floors (your applications). But what about the elevator shafts and ventilation systems that connect everything? That’s where virtualization often lurks, and if not properly secured, it can become the Achilles’ heel of your cloud fortress.

One of the most common blind spots is the hypervisor. This is the software that creates and runs your virtual machines (VMs). If a hypervisor is compromised, an attacker could potentially gain control over all the VMs running on that host. Imagine a disgruntled janitor with a master key to every apartment in your building – not a comforting thought! Similarly, VM escape vulnerabilities allow malicious code running inside a VM to break out and affect the host or other VMs. It’s like a prisoner digging a tunnel out of their cell and then breaking into the warden’s office.

Building Your Virtual Fortress: Key Security Pillars

So, how do we prevent our digital metropolis from being overrun by cyber-scoundrels? It’s not about throwing more locks at the problem; it’s about a strategic, multi-layered approach to virtualization security in cloud computing.

#### Isolating Your Digital Neighborhoods (Segmentation)

Just as you wouldn’t want your noisy neighbours accidentally bursting into your living room, you certainly don’t want one compromised VM to wreak havoc on others. Network segmentation is your best friend here. By dividing your virtual network into smaller, isolated segments, you limit the lateral movement of threats.

Micro-segmentation: This goes a step further, allowing you to define security policies at the individual VM level. Think of it as having a bouncer for every single room in your virtual mansion, not just the front door.
VLANs and Firewalls: These are your classic security guards, ensuring that traffic only goes where it’s supposed to. Proper configuration here is non-negotiable.

#### Guarding the Gates: Identity and Access Management (IAM)

Who gets to go where, and what can they do when they get there? This is the golden question of IAM. In a virtualized environment, this becomes even more critical.

Principle of Least Privilege: Users and applications should only have the permissions they absolutely need to perform their tasks. No more, no less.
Multi-Factor Authentication (MFA): This is the digital equivalent of needing a key, a code, and a fingerprint to enter a high-security area. It significantly reduces the risk of unauthorized access.
Role-Based Access Control (RBAC): Assigning permissions based on job roles simplifies management and reduces human error.

#### Keeping Your Digital Doors Locked: Patching and Configuration Management

It sounds almost too simple, but keeping your virtualization software and operating systems up-to-date is paramount. Those security patches released by vendors aren’t just suggestions; they’re often critical fixes for gaping holes.

Automated Patching: Wherever possible, automate the patching process to ensure consistency and timeliness.
Secure Configuration Baselines: Establish and enforce secure configurations for all your virtual components. A misconfigured VM is an open invitation.

#### The Ever-Vigilant Watcher: Monitoring and Logging

You can’t fix what you don’t see. Comprehensive monitoring and logging are essential for detecting suspicious activity before it escalates.

Log Aggregation: Collect logs from all your virtual machines, hypervisors, and network devices into a central location.
Intrusion Detection/Prevention Systems (IDS/IPS): These systems act as your digital alarm system, flagging and potentially blocking malicious traffic.
Behavioral Analysis: Look for anomalies in user and system behavior that might indicate a compromise.

When Things Get Hairy: Incident Response in the Virtual Realm

Despite your best efforts, breaches can still happen. Having a well-defined incident response plan is crucial, and in a virtualized environment, it needs a few extra considerations.

VM Snapshots for Forensics: Before making changes, take snapshots of compromised VMs. This allows for detailed forensic analysis without losing the original state.
Rapid Isolation: Be able to quickly isolate affected VMs or even entire hosts to prevent further spread.
* Automated Remediation: For known threats, consider automating response actions to speed up recovery.

The Future is Still Virtual, and Still Needs Guarding

The journey into the cloud, powered by virtualization, is an exciting one. However, overlooking virtualization security in cloud computing is akin to packing for a tropical vacation and forgetting sunscreen – you’re going to get burned. By understanding the unique challenges and implementing robust security measures, you can ensure your virtual empire remains a secure and thriving space. It’s about being proactive, staying vigilant, and never underestimating the ingenuity of those who want to cause trouble. After all, who wants their virtual castle to be the one with the easily picked digital lock?

Wrapping Up: Embrace Vigilance, Not Complacency

Ultimately, robust virtualization security in cloud computing isn’t a one-time fix; it’s an ongoing commitment. It requires a blend of technical solutions, vigilant practices, and a culture that prioritizes security. Don’t let the perceived complexity of virtual environments lull you into a false sense of security. Instead, embrace the challenge, implement these strategies, and build a cloud infrastructure that is not just agile and scalable, but also remarkably secure. Because in the grand theatre of the digital world, a secure foundation is the only way to ensure a standing ovation, not a swift eviction.

Leave a Reply